I am going to have to agree with you 100% Nelly, if you think about it Jay has had to play two characters, in both season one and season two. First in season one, he plays Vincent who is this tortured, gentle soul who has remorse for the terrible things he has done, then in the same episode he has had to switch to the Beast, who has his humanity removed but still managed to always do the right thing. Remember Catherine said in season one, " Even when you kill people, you are doing it to protecting someone!" Now compare that to season two, Jay is very believable in showing us the Beast is no longer in touch with the human side of himself and is basically following orders with no remorse for what he is doing. And yet when he is with Catherine Jay/Vincent shows us the cracks that we all believe will lead him down the road for finding his inner Vincent. It takes great skill to show multiple sides of a complex character. Yes he is supported by a great cast of amazing actors but the show could only work if the actor who plays the Beast makes himself venerable to us. We needed to feel empathy for a character who does indeed maul people to death! Jay is truly a great actor to take us on this journey with him and as such, I understand why the show runners are quick to tell us what an outstanding screen presence he has.
